英文摘要
DESCRIPTION (Adapted from the Applicant's Abstract): Tuberculosis has
been classified as an emerging and re-emerging infectious disease.
Contributing to its public health importance is the co-existing
progression of the AIDS pandemic and the development of drug-resistant
strains of Mycobacterium tuberculosis. This has lead to the recognition
that more needs to be learned about essential metabolic pathways of the
organism to provide a factual basis for the development of new
antibiotics. This project addresses this question, proposing experiments
designed to identify biosynthetic components of the metabolic pathway
of mycolic acids, essential molecules of the M. tuberculosis cell wall.
The research plan calls for the use of two new technologies of the
"post-genomic era": use of the complete annotated M. tuberculosis genome
and mRNA gene response profiling by microarray competitive
hybridization. Microarray-based results will be complemented by
biochemical and mutational studies performed in collaboration with Drs.
Patrick Brennan and Brigitte Gicquel, respectively. In the terminal
phase of this study, newly-identified mycolic acid biosynthetic enzymes
will be examined in a group of isogenic pairs of strains which have
evolved from isoniazid-sensitive to isoniazid-resistant during
treatment. If successful, these studies should provide new information
about mechanisms of drug-action and drug-resistance and suggest novel
drug targets within the mycolic acid metabolic pathway.
